description Sonos Roam Portable Speaker Overview

The Sonos Roam is a versatile portable speaker perfect for enhancing the home office environment. Its compact size and robust design allow for easy portability, while the integrated Wi-Fi and Bluetooth connectivity provide seamless streaming. The Sonos ecosystem integration offers access to a vast library of music and podcasts, creating a more enjoyable and productive workspace.

help Sonos Roam Portable Speaker FAQ

Is the Sonos Roam waterproof and suitable for shower use?

Yes, the Sonos Roam boasts an IP67 dust and waterproof rating, meaning it can be fully submerged in water up to 1 meter deep for 30 minutes. This durability makes it perfectly safe for use in the bathroom, at the beach, or by the pool without fear of splashes damaging it. Just ensure the USB-C charging port is completely dry before plugging it in to avoid corrosion.

Can the Sonos Roam connect to my TV via Bluetooth?

While the Sonos Roam has Bluetooth capabilities, Sonos speakers do not support direct Bluetooth audio syncing with televisions or the Sonos Arc soundbar. The Roam is designed primarily for streaming music via Wi-Fi using the Sonos app or direct Bluetooth from a phone. For TV audio, you would need a Sonos soundbar like the Beam or Ray connected via HDMI-ARC or optical cable.

What is Sonos Trueplay tuning on the Roam?

Trueplay is Sonos' proprietary software that analyzes the acoustics of the room and adjusts the speaker's EQ to sound optimal in that specific space. The Roam features Automatic Trueplay, which continuously utilizes its built-in microphone to adjust the sound on the fly as you move it between rooms. This ensures the audio always sounds rich and balanced, whether it's in a small bathroom or a large open kitchen.

How long does the battery last on the Sonos Roam?

The Sonos Roam offers up to 10 hours of continuous playback on a single charge, depending on the volume level and whether you are using Wi-Fi or Bluetooth. When placed into sleep mode, the battery can last up to 10 days on standby. It conveniently charges via a standard USB-C cable or the dedicated Sonos wireless charging base accessory.
